OPEC's Crude Production Rose Slightly in 1991 but Value of Exports Dropped
OPEC's crude oil production rose slightly in 1991, but the value of itspetroleum exports declined sharply by more than 12%, according to the 1991 OPECAnnual Statistical Bulletin which has just been released. Total crude oilproduction in 1991 amounted to 23.34mn b/d, an increase of 0.35% over the 1990level of 23.26mn b/d. However, the value of petroleum exports dropped by 12.3%from...
